Air Fryer Caramelized Bananas

1/2 tsp vanilla extract

check

1/2 tsp ground cinnamon

check

2 large bananas, peeled and cut into 1/2 inch slices

check

1 tbsp salted butter, melted

check

1 tbsp brown sugar

Instructions

  • 1

    (Preheat air fryer to 390 degrees F (195 degrees C))

  • 2

    (Spread out banana slices on a plate. Combine butter and vanilla extract and drizzle over the bananas.)

  • 3

    (Combine brown sugar and cinnamon. Sprinkle half of the sugar mixture over the slices, flip, and sprinkle the remaining sugar over the other side. Make sure both sides are well coated.)

  • 4

    (Spray the air fryer basket with cooking spray or line with a parchment paper.)

  • 5

    (Place banana slices in the air fryer basket in a single layermaking sure not to overcrowd or overlap. Cook until golden brown and caramelized to your liking, 7 to 9 minutes. You do not need to flip banana slices over.)

  • 6

    (Remove bananas from the basket, cool slightly, and serve.)

  • 7

    (Depending on the size of your air fryer you may need to fry bananas in batches.)

  • 8

    (Cooking time may vary depending on the size and brand of your air fryer. If you are only have unsalted butter, add a pinch of salt.)
